No Health-Based Violations

None of the 2 water systems serving this ZIP have exceeded federal contaminant limits in the past 5 years. There are7 monitoring/reporting violations (missed testing deadlines), all resolved.

Better than 60% of US ZIP codes.

Based on EPA compliance data. Not a substitute for an official water quality report from your utility.
